No. Medical assistants may not place the needle or start and … WebSchedule V, low abuse potential, to Schedule I, high abuse potential and no accepted medical use. Schedule V medications are generally used for antitussive, antidiarrheal and analgesic purposes. These medications include drugs with limited codeine content (Robitussin AC®), diphenoxylate (Lomotil®), and pregabalin (Lyrica®).

WebYes, Medical assistants can give injections such as vaccines, hormone shots, flu shots and allergy shots. Each state offers its own scope of practice laws for medical assistants and some states address injections and … WebThe phrase “administer medications” refers to the direct application of medication by simple injections, ingestion and inhalation, or pre-measured medications. For the Board’s purposes, the phrase "administer medications" regarding a medical assistant means to inject, handle, or provide medications to a patient after a physician ...
